Sorry to ask a tedious question - but does anyone know how to transfer Audiobooks (as opposed to podcasts) from iTunes to iPhone? Bit stuck?

This instruction is based on audiobooks purchased from Audible. Com - Go to audible. Com and login with your details.

- Download the audiobooks in Audible audio file (the file extension is usually . Aa) - Start iTunes. - Drag the audible files to the iTunes window.

- If this is the first time you add Audible file, iTunes will prompt your account details. Enter the relevant information. Once the audiobook file is in the iTunes, you can connect the iPhone to the computer and sync the contents to your iPhone.
